A New Year Facelift

I have enjoyed every thing about our home since moving in other than the fact that there was no color on the inside. Everything, and I mean everything was chalky white throughout. We have added color starting with the kids bedrooms, the entry way, sun room and office over the past year but the rest of the main floor needed some loving color. Here are some before photos.I have been looking for the perfect color for the formal living room and dining room to go with the decor I have assembled. The color that came out the winner was Valspars' "Tropical Bay" from Lowe's.


This was a 2 day 2 person project that truly rang in the New Year! I also wanted to add some design to the dining area and went with the vertical stripes painted in "Brushed Pearl". The keys to making this part of the project a success were 1) a laser level capable of making vertical lines 2) Frog Tape- I highly recommend this product, there was no paint bleeding under the tape and lines came out crisp and clean. 3) Layout- Take your time and double check before you start painting. The method we used to layout the room was to measure the total length of all walls around the room. We divided this total distance by an even number that would give us a stripe width between 8 to 10 inches. In our case the stripes came out to be 8 15/16" to make all the stripes the same. If we would have made all the stripes and even 9" we would have had 1 stripe only 4 1/2" wide instead of 9". The final phase of this project will be completing the curtains but that will be a project for another day and another post. Here is how it turned out.
